STAND 4 KIDS!

PALMDALE & LANCASTER, CA-Action for Kids has organized two public events as we stand together in solidarity with everyone who is a protector of children.
We will gather with our neighbors and community members on April 1st and April 2nd to raise public awareness and show support for children. Stand 4 Kids holding signs with positive messages to send commuters home in a better mood thus preventing child abuse that day.

On April 1st, we will be in Palmdale, from 5:30 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. along Avenue S, from the 14 freeway exit to 25th Street East.
On April 2nd, we will be in Lancaster from 5:30 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. on Avenue K and 15th Street West by the 14 freeway exit.

“The Antelope Valley has the highest reported cases of child abuse and neglect in Los Angeles County. By bringing awareness to the public, we have the power to change our children’s future for the better,” said Rosie Mainella, Executive Director of Action for Kids.
About Action for Kids
Founded in May 1998, it was restructured in 2018. Action for Kids is a California nonprofit public benefit corporation that seeks to enhance the lives of all people and decrease child abuse, violence, crime, isolation, and suicide issues through community connections and actions in Antelope Valley.
We are one of twelve Los Angeles County Community Child Abuse Prevention Councils (CAPC) and part of the Inter-agencyCouncil on Child Abuse and Neglect (ICAN). We support, collaborate with, and partner with all organizations in the Antelope Valley and beyond that address child abuse and prevention issues.
